Scoresheet and Answer Submission Form (Google Forms Template)
2020年4月27日 · To use the spreadsheet. Delete the sample data in the Form Responses 1 sheet. Send the players a link to the form. (tell them to use the exact same team name throughout, and they will benefit from having two devices. One to watch the stream of you reading questions, and a phone to submit the form in. Or a laptop that can have both things open ...

Help scoring a trivia game. Is this possible? : r/excel - Reddit
2019年10月28日 · Have a data sheet Column A: Team Names Column B: Points Keep a running tally on sheet 1. Then on sheet 2 do a sum of values and the teams. Then it will automatically sum points and add new teams if they join in the middle (i.e bar trivia).

I am running a trivia night and use Google Sheets to track my
2020年5月1日 · In another Google sheet, I use a =sumif function to pull their score from the connected Google sheet and display their score for that round. For example: Team A has their Round 1 scores populated into "Google Sheet 1". Column A in "Google Sheet 1" is the team name, columns B through L are their answers, and column M is their total score for the ...
Keeping Score with a dozen teams : r/trivia - Reddit
2016年10月4日 · Then when announcing score, select all, go to Data > Sort… > Sort by Total Score > A-Z. Then you can just read out the first two columns in order. Edit: Here's a basic sheet on Google Docs with this format and 5 rounds. If you change the number of rounds just make sure to edit the formula for Total Score.

2020年5月1日 · That feeds into a google sheet. I take that raw data and I create a query to bring it into my grading sheet. The grading sheet has some formulas and conditional formatting that makes it obvious which question it is. Then I just run down the answers and grade them with a 1 for a correct answer and leave blank for incorrect.
